Class 2 Driver - Hereford

Flexible Full-Time Options (Choose Your Days)

£17 per hour (inc hol)

Are you an experienced driver looking for a role that fits your schedule? We are hiring Class 2 Drivers to deliver palletised goods in Hereford, with flexible work days available. Choose from Monday to Friday with start times between 5 AM and 8 AM.

What we are looking for:

  • Valid C Cat Driving Licence
  • CPC & Tacho Certification
  • No more than 6 points on your driving licence
  • Strong communication skills to interact with customers and team members
